Population growth, urbanisation, increased travel and migration, and changing ecosystems are just some of the factors contributing to changes in infectious disease epidemiology. There is an urgent need to develop the capacity of the health workforce's knowledge of the theory and principles of control of infectious diseases in this evolving scenario.The Graduate Certificate in Infectious Diseases Intelligence develops your skills in effective prevention or control of infectious diseases. You get exposed to a range of courses including Infectious Disease Intelligence and Bioterrorism and Health Intelligence. This Graduate Diploma, offered entirely online, articulates with the Masters of Infectious Disease Intelligence, Master of Public Health in Infectious Diseases Epidemiology specialisation as well as the Master of International Health

Data scientists and analysts are in high demand from industry and government. As billions of devices feed data to central databases, businesses require experts to interpret that data. This degree blends mathematical methods, statistics, computing, business decisions and communication to give you the theoretical and practical skills you need to enter this lucrative field. You will benefit from expertise across three different schools at UNSW - Mathematics and Statistics, Computer Science and Engineering, and Economics - and will have the choice of majors from quantitative data science, business data science or computational data science.

Computer science is the study of the design, construction and use of computer systems. This degree focuses on comprehension of the basic principles behind computing tools, operating systems, compilers and translators, and computer hardware. You will study the representation of data and data structures and the design of algorithms for programming languages and machine systems. A main focus is the design and development of hardware and software tools for developing computer applications. Non-computing elements, which can often determine the success of computing systems (such as human interface or psychological aspects), are also considered within the design and development process.
